Subject: [PATCH v3 09/25] crypto: qat - split PFVF message decoding from handling

Refactor the receive and handle logic to separate the parsing and
handling of the PFVF message from the initial retrieval and ACK.

This is to allow the intoduction of the recv function in a subsequent
patch.
